Understanding CE, RoHS and FCC: scope, requirements and how they apply to pomodoro timers
CE marking: directives and technical files
CE marking is a declaration that a product meets EU safety, EMC and other relevant directives. For a typical electronic pomodoro timer, the relevant legislation usually includes the Low Voltage Directive (LVD) and the Electromagnetic Compatibility (EMC) Directive. The EU Commission provides guidance on applicable directives and conformity assessment procedures (EC CE marking guidance). Manufacturers must compile a technical file, risk assessment, user instructions and an EU Declaration of Conformity.
RoHS: restricting hazardous substances
RoHS (Restriction of Hazardous Substances Directive) limits certain substances such as lead (Pb), mercury (Hg), cadmium (Cd), hexavalent chromium (Cr(VI)), PBB and PBDE in electrical and electronic equipment. RoHS compliance is required for placing EEE on the EU market and impacts PCB assembly, solder, component selection and supply chain declarations. Official RoHS info is on the EU environment portal (EU RoHS).
FCC: emissions and radio (if applicable)
In the United States, the Federal Communications Commission (FCC) regulates unintentional and intentional radio emissions. Most battery-powered digital timers with no radio modules fall under FCC Part 15 unintentional radiator rules; devices with Bluetooth or Wi‑Fi need additional authorization (e.g., FCC certification/DoC for wireless modules). See FCC equipment authorization guidance (FCC).
Practical compliance roadmap for pomodoro timers
Design-phase decisions that reduce compliance risk
Start compliance early: choose UL/EN recognized components, follow PCB layout best practices for EMC, select RoHS-compliant solder and components, and decide whether the product will include any radio (Bluetooth/Wi‑Fi). Choose power sources and charging circuitry that meet the expected markets’ safety norms.
Testing matrix and laboratories
Create a testing matrix that maps product variants to required tests (safety, EMC, RoHS). Use accredited labs (ISO/IEC 17025) for EMC and safety testing and ensure test reports identify the sample and firmware level. National accreditation bodies and lists of accredited labs help selection; for example, check NANDO/EA or local accreditation bodies. For FCC testing, labs listed by the FCC or recognized Telecommunication Certification Bodies (TCBs) should be used.
Documentation, quality system and post-market surveillance
Maintain a technical file with schematics, BOM, test reports, risk assessment and user manual. Implement a basic QMS aligned with ISO 9001 to control changes and suppliers (ISO). Keep supplier declarations for RoHS and retain retention samples for future testing.
Comparing CE, RoHS and FCC: what manufacturers need to know
At-a-glance comparison
Use the following table to compare the three regimes and plan timelines.
| Regime | Scope | Key requirements | Typical tests | Applicability to pomodoro timer |
|---|---|---|---|---|
| CE (EU) | EU market (safety, EMC) | Technical file, Declaration of Conformity, CE mark | Safety (EN/IEC standards), EMC (EN 55032/55035) | Yes — mandatory for sales in EU |
| RoHS (EU) | Restriction of hazardous substances in EEE | Materials compliance, supplier declarations, testing as needed | Material analysis (XRF/chemical) & supplier DCF | Yes — affects BOM, solder and components |
| FCC (US) | US market (radio & emissions) | FCC DoC/Certification depending on radio use | Radiated & conducted emissions (Part 15), radio tests if applicable | Yes — mandatory for US; additional if device has wireless |
Timelines and cost considerations
Typical timelines: initial lab testing 2–6 weeks; corrective redesigns add 1–4 weeks; final reports and documentation another 1–2 weeks. Costs vary by lab, scope and number of variants: simple emissions/safety tests may range from a few thousand to $10k+ per variant in many regions. Wireless certification and module approvals can add further costs. Accurate budgeting requires a defined BOM and firmware build.
Common pitfalls and how to avoid them
Common mistakes include: late-stage radio/firmware changes invalidating test reports, using non-declared components (RoHS gaps), poor PCB grounding leading to EMC failures, and incomplete technical files. Prevent these by freezing BOMs before testing, using module suppliers with issued certificates for wireless, and following EMC-aware PCB layout guidelines.
Supply chain controls and launch checklist
Supplier declarations and component traceability
Collect supplier declarations of conformity (DoC) for RoHS and maintain Certificates of Compliance for critical parts (power adapters, batteries, wireless modules). A traceable BOM and incoming inspection plan reduce downstream risk and ease market audits.
Factory audits, production testing and labeling
Conduct on-site or third-party factory audits that verify process control, soldering quality, and final inspection routines. Implement production line testing such as functional checks, hipot for insulation, and random EMC pre-tests on production samples. Ensure permanent marking/labeling (CE mark, identification, user info) complies with local rules.
Post-market monitoring and handling non-conformities
Set up a system to collect field failure data and complaints. If a non-conformity is found, be prepared with a corrective action plan, customer communications, and (if needed) a recall strategy. Retain test samples to reproduce any failures reported in the field.

Frequently Asked Questions
1. Do I always need CE and RoHS for a pomodoro timer sold in Europe?
Yes. Most electronic timers intended for EU sales require CE marking (covering safety and EMC as applicable) and RoHS compliance for materials. Specific directives depend on product features; consult the EU CE guidance (EC CE marking guidance).
2. My timer only has a small microcontroller and no wireless—do I still need FCC testing for the US?
Yes, as an unintentional radiator your device must comply with FCC Part 15 emission limits. Testing for radiated and conducted emissions is usually required. If the unit includes a separate pre-certified wireless module, additional module documentation may be required.
3. How do I prove RoHS compliance for parts from multiple suppliers?
Collect Supplier Declarations of Conformity and material declarations for each BOM item. Use targeted testing (XRF screening, chemical analysis) for high-risk components. Maintain documentation in your technical file to demonstrate due diligence.
4. What should be in the technical file for CE?
A CE technical file typically includes: product description and drawings, applicable standards, risk assessment, test reports (EMC, safety), BOM and component info, user manual, factory quality controls, and the EU Declaration of Conformity.
5. Can I use pre-certified modules to speed up wireless certification?
Yes. Using a pre-certified radio module can significantly shorten FCC/CE radio approval time, but you must ensure correct integration (antenna, shielding, firmware) and keep module documentation in your file. Integration testing is still required to confirm emissions in the final assembly.
6. How much does certification typically cost and how long will it take?
Costs vary by scope, regions and number of variants. Expect laboratory testing and documentation to start in the low thousands USD for a simple unlicensed device and scale up with added wireless or more rigorous safety testing. Timelines are typically 4–10 weeks from first lab submission to final report if no redesigns are needed.
